Serbia's basketball cup final was completed in an empty arena Monday after fighting between rival fans a day earlier forced the game to be stopped.

Red Star beat Partizan 78-69 a day after fans turned violent in the third quarter. They stormed the court and hurled smoke bombs. The score was 43-43.

It was decided the game would resume Monday without fans.

Violence at sports events is frequent in Serbia despite new laws that include prison terms for those involved and heavy fines for the clubs.

Similar violence marred the Greek Cup final in Athens on Sunday. The game was halted for an hour before Panathinaikos defeated archrival Olympiakos 81-78.
